Tokyo Extreme Racer 2 Save Patch Help!

Hi! I am having trouble trying to install the save patch for Tokyo Extreme Racer 2. Everytime I type in this line from the text file:

"Create the data ISO: MKISOFS.EXE -C 0,11700 -V TXR2_ECH -l -o C:\TXR2\DATA.ISO C:\TXR2\DATA
This will create C:\TXR2\DATA.ISO from the files in C:\TXR\DATA\"

I get the following error message:

mkisofs 1.13a03 (i586-pc-cygwin)
/MKISOFS.EXE: No such file or directory. Invalid node - txr2_ech

I have copied EVERYTHING from the first burnt copy of TXR2 into the SAME directories as the TEXT file. Please help me guys! Thanks!

Hi Gui !

You have to put your "Data" folder into the same directory where "mkisofs.exe" is.
then you will have "mkisofs -C 0,11700 -V BLaBla -l -o data.iso data"

and it will work.
